Output 8f5938811e0053f64ae913a70529c89997eeb19292f5eb72b8458278d14b1b3e:0

value
81369133
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8afb2830ef6fae6b78bd6f843c123f0a59547f4c OP_EQUALVERIFY OP_CHECKSIG
address
1Dfs8AfeFFWMHf1w528j28XhAv1CESzPbR
transaction
8f5938811e0053f64ae913a70529c89997eeb19292f5eb72b8458278d14b1b3e
spent
true